Sample job description warehouse manager

A sample job description is drawn up taking into account the professional standard Support specialist construction industry materials and structures

1. General Provisions

1.1. The warehouse manager belongs to the category of managers.

1.2. A person with an average professional education for training programs for mid-level specialists.

1.3. The Warehouse Manager must:

1) the range and main characteristics of building and auxiliary materials and equipment;

2) the procedure for accounting, acceptance, issuance of building and auxiliary materials and equipment;

3) standards and specifications for the storage of building and auxiliary materials and equipment;

4) the procedure for writing off and accounting for construction and auxiliary materials and equipment;

5) rules for warehouse accounting and preparation of material reports on the movement of goods, as well as primary documents;

6) rules for conducting an inventory of building and auxiliary materials and equipment;

7) requirements for standardized stocks of construction and auxiliary materials and equipment;

8) rules for maintaining the temperature and humidity regime and other technical conditions for the storage of building and auxiliary materials and equipment;

9) requirements for equipping warehouses with loading and unloading machines and mechanisms and rules for placing construction and auxiliary materials and equipment;

10) norms, rules and instructions for labor protection when working on the territory of the warehouse and using loading and unloading machines and mechanisms;

11) the procedure for actions in the event of a fire, floods and other emergencies;

12) methods of information processing using software and computer facilities;

13) Internal labor regulations;

14) labor protection requirements and fire safety rules;

1.4. The warehouse manager must be able to:

1) place material and technical resources on the warehouse territory, taking into account the rational use of warehouse space, facilitating the search for stored products and access to them for loading and removal from the warehouse;

2) classify primary documents according to material and technical resources arriving at the warehouse;

3) form and maintain a system of accounting and reporting documentation on the movement (income, consumption) of material and technical resources in the warehouse;

4) work with a computer as a user using specialized software;

5) to identify, on the basis of warehouse accounting data, deviations of the actual balance of stored goods from the established stock rate, as well as residues that are not in motion;

6) apply the rules for the inventory of building and auxiliary materials and equipment;

7) use devices for monitoring the temperature and humidity conditions and other technical conditions for the storage of building and auxiliary materials and equipment;

8) organize the activities of warehouse workers and drivers of loading and unloading machines and mechanisms in the warehouse in compliance with the norms, rules and instructions for labor protection and fire safety;

9) develop and implement measures to restore the mode of storage of building and auxiliary materials and equipment in the warehouse;

10) use the video surveillance system outside the warehouses;

2. Labor functions

2.1. Organization of warehouse work:

1) acceptance and storage of construction and auxiliary materials and equipment;

2) organizing the issuance of construction and auxiliary materials and equipment;

3) creation of conditions for safe storage and safety of stored building materials and equipment.

2.2. ……… (other functions)

3. Job responsibilities

3.1. The warehouse manager has the following responsibilities:

3.1.1. As part of the labor function specified in paragraphs. 1 clause 2.1 of this job description:

1) ensures the readiness of the necessary equipment and the territory of the warehouse for unloading, as well as places for warehousing and storage in accordance with the established rules for the placement of goods;

2) organizes the acceptance of construction and auxiliary materials and equipment: unloading and delivery of goods to storage sites, taking into account the rational use of storage space, facilitating access to stored products, their search, loading and removal from the warehouse;

3) draws up a card file of warehouse accounting, makes entries in it on the basis of duly executed and executed primary documents;

4) keeps records of the remains of building and auxiliary materials and equipment stored in the warehouse, compares the quantity indicated in the primary documents with the established consumption limit.

3.1.2. As part of the labor function specified in paragraphs. 2 clause 2.1 of this job description:

1) receive documents for the issuance of construction and auxiliary materials and equipment;

2) carries out the issuance of construction and auxiliary materials and equipment, the organization of shipment and the introduction of relevant entries in the accounting system;

3) draws up and submits to the accounting department of a construction organization material reports reflecting the movement (income, consumption) of construction and auxiliary materials and equipment;

4) organizes the verification of the actual availability of building and auxiliary materials and equipment, as well as the write-off of the resources stored in the warehouse that have become unusable;

5) prepares information on deviations of the actual balance of stored goods from the established reserve norm, as well as on the balances that are not in motion, in order to make a decision on their liquidation.

3.1.3. As part of the labor function specified in paragraphs. 3 clause 2.1 of this job description:

1) instruct warehouse workers on labor protection, make entries on the briefing in a special journal;

2) familiarize warehouse workers with the rules for ensuring the safety of building and auxiliary materials and equipment stored in the warehouse;

3) ensures compliance with the temperature and humidity conditions and other technical conditions for the storage of building and auxiliary materials and equipment;

4) exercise control over the performance of loading and unloading operations during the acceptance and release of material assets in order to ensure their safety;

5) organizes a video surveillance system and controls the security of the warehouse territory;

6) ensure the maintenance of access roads.

Warehouse manager is an employee who manages the work of a warehouse, organizes the reception, issuance and safety of material assets in it. If the warehouse of the enterprise is large enough and involves the storage of a large amount of equipment, such a position, as a rule, is available. In addition to him, other workers whom he supervises (loaders, storekeepers) can work in the premises. The duties of the warehouse manager at the warehouse also include knowledge of the rules for processing documents (receipt-expenditure, inventory). He bears full individual financial responsibility for the safety of the property entrusted to him, his shortage. If employees subordinate to him perform work on the acceptance for storage, processing (manufacturing), storage, accounting, release (issuance) of material assets, then collective liability may be introduced (Resolution of the Ministry of Labor of the Russian Federation of December 31, 2002 No. 85).

Job description of the head

After the duties are defined for the warehouse manager, they need to be fixed in a special document. Note that it does not use such a concept as a job description, and does not consider it a mandatory document. In practice, it is considered the main document that determines the employee's labor obligations. We advise you to develop such a document for the warehouse manager in production, this will allow you to avoid conflicts with the employee, competently organize his work, and also clearly define not only the duties of the warehouse manager in the warehouse, but also the boundaries of his liability.

The instruction usually consists of the following sections:

  • general provisions;
  • job duties of the employee;
  • employee rights;
  • employee responsibility;
  • final provisions.

Sections can be named differently by adding additional ones (for example, about interaction with subordinate employees, employees of other departments, etc.). To fill the section "Warehouse Manager - Job Responsibilities" follow the CAS, supplementing and correcting the provisions of this handbook.

Fill out the section “Rights and responsibilities of an employee” based on the general requirements of labor legislation. Usually, the rights of the warehouse manager include: the right to demand the provision of information and documents from other departments, to give instructions, etc.

In the "Responsibility" section, as a rule, there is an indication of the possibility of bringing to disciplinary and material liability.
